Genderlink, another Chinese scam
Another Chinese scam. First of all, the product they sent me is nothing like the one described on their website; its vastly inferior to what I expected when I ordered. The second part of this total scam is the return deal. The website return policy says just send it back for a full refund, less shipping. Sounds perfectly normal and reasonable, right? Wrong. They don't tell you this little detail in their policy statement, but you have a very short time in which to return the item, and you must return it only using US Post Office (no FEDEX or UPS etc.) AND you have to ship it to their location in CHINA!
Their first email to me regarding returning the clothing did not say it had to be sent to China, but did say - if I met their very detailed return criteria, I could keep (the useless) item and Genderlink would refund 15% of the item price. I replied that I met their return criteria and would return the item, I assumed to their US distribution address, at my expense, for the full price refund. Their second email then revealed that I'd get no refund if I sent it to the US address, and instead I'd have to send it to China. They did, however, sweeten their deal by offering for me to keep the item and they'd send me a 25% refund. In short, this company is a complete scam. and caution: this methodology is trending; there are several other sites now pulling this same scam; so try to find honest, independent reviews (not AI generated fake reviews) before ordering. Will I ever get my 25% refund? I'll update this review and let you know. But don't hold your breath!
